TextTest

Software kuvakaappaus:
TextTest
Ohjelmiston tiedot:
Versio: 3.28.2 Päivitetty
Lähetyksen päivämäärä: 18 Jul 15
Kehittäjä: Geoff Bache
Lupa: Vapaa
Suosio: 40

Rating: 5.0/5 (Total Votes: 1)

Kuten nimestä voi päätellä, TextTest hanke toimii kautta verrattiin pelkkää tekstiä kirjaamat ohjelmia aiemman "kultakanta versiona että tekstiä.
Tämä on toisin kuin useimmat vastaanottotarkastus kehysten tarjolla tänään, joka yleensä käyttää jonkinlaista käsin kirjoitettu väittävät ", jonka testi kirjailija, joka kyseenalaistaa hakemuksen API.

Mikä on uusi tässä julkaisussa:

  • tehdä tappaminen testit Windows kun käynnissä rinnakkain toimivat paremmin

Mikä on uusi versiossa 3.26:

  • Nyt on mahdollista saada erilliset alueet lokit (jaettu levy) ja hiekkalaatikko (paikalliselle levylle).
  • dynaaminen käyttöliittymä näyttää nyt esikatselun tiedostot verrattuna tasavertaisina.
  • tehtiin parannuksia Jenkins plugin ja integrointi StoryText editori GUI testausta.

Mikä on uusi versiossa 3.24:

  • Tämä versio lisätty Jenkins yhdentymisen HTML-raportteja, ja suoraan yhdistää muuttaa ja vikakorjaus tiedot. Alpha tukea lisättiin Condor.
  • kolmas Grid Engine annettiin lisäksi GE ja LSF (Condor toimii paremmin Windows).
  • uusi run_dependent_text syntaksin annettiin löytää myöhemmin ottelut tiedostoon.

Mikä on uusi versiossa 3.22:

  • Hakuavut ovat mehiläinen lisätään HTML-raportti.
  • On olemassa muita mahdollisuuksia run_dependent_text ja kopioimalla datatiedostot.
  • On kuusi kuukautta arvoinen yleensä pieniä parannuksia ja bugikorjauksia.

Mikä on uusi versiossa 3.20:

  • Eri parannuksia ja korjauksia tehtiin.
  • Erityisesti, testejä voidaan uusintana dynaamisen GUI eri asetuksilla.
  • Config tiedosto voidaan nyt muuttaa kohti-testiä.
  • & quot; tunnettu bugi & quot; joka käynnistää uusimiselle testin jopa tietyn määrän kertoja voidaan ajaa.
  • Tämä julkaisu vaatii Python 2.6 ja PyGTK 2.16 tai uudempi.

Mikä on uusi versiossa 3.19:

  • Eri parannuksia ja korjauksia tehtiin.
  • GUI parannuksia tehtiin keskitytään käytettävyyteen.
  • Lisälaitteet tehtiin & quot; tunnettua virhettä & quot; toimintoa.
  • Sun Grid Engine pollataan tehdä tilan testit sen näkyvyyttä.
  • Huomaa, että tämä on viimeinen julkaisu, joka tukee Python 2.4 ja 2.5: TextTest 3,20 vaatii Python 2.6 ja luultavasti GTK 2.18 samoin.

Mikä on uusi versiossa 3.16.1:

  • korjauksia 3.16:
  • selvittäneet -valintanappi nimeäminen, mikä oli outoa melko harvoissa tapauksissa (guiplugins.py)
  • Ei enää sivuuttaa & quot; vanilja & quot; lippu, kun löytää UI kartta tiedostot (pyusecase_interface.py)
  • Korjaukset ikääntyvien vikoja:
  • Älä stacktrace jos dynaaminen GUI ikkuna on suljettu testit käynnissä (controller.py)
  • hidastettu toisto valintaruutu näkyy tuonnin jälkeen uusi GUI-sovellus testi (runningactions.py)
  • Tallennus-välilehti ei enää näy tuomisen jälkeen ei GUI hakemuksen testi (guiplugins.py)
  • & quot; Tallenna Käytä-tapaus & quot; pysyy harmaana jos hakemus testattavan ei GUI (guiplugins.py)
  • Kiinteä vika, jos toistuvia ei-tarkkaa tulosta liikenteen replay ei tuottanut ne oikeassa järjestyksessä (traffic.py)
  • Kiinteät suorituskykyongelman monia tuomittu yrittää tuoda olematonta GUI kokoonpano moduulit (guiplugins.py)
  • copy_test_path_merge nyt myös yhdistää alihakemistoja kuten pitääkin (sandbox.py)

Mikä on uusi versiossa 3.16:

  • Staattinen GUI parannukset:
  • Voi nyt nimetä tiedostoja pudotusvalikosta tiedostoon näkymä (adminactions.py)
  • & quot; Päivitä & quot; korvaa & quot; Poista Testit & quot; vuonna oletuksena työkalupalkissa, lähinnä esteettisistä syistä (default_gui-static.xml)
  • työkalupalkin sisältö voidaan konfiguroida / laittaa takaisin, katso & quot; henkilökohtaistaminen UI & quot; verkkosivuilla
  • & quot; Lisää sovellus & quot; dialogi on nyt pudotusvalikosta kaikista mahdollisista GUI-testaus vaihtoehtoja (adminactions.py)
  • Voit aloittaa testaus käyttöliittymän ennen ymmärrystä config tiedosto
  • Virhe käsittely alkuperäisen & quot; Lisää sovellus & quot; valintaikkuna parantunut (adminactions.py)
  • Hylkää laitonta merkkiä pääte ja alihakemistonimet
  • GUI-testaus & quot; UI kartta & quot; tiedostoja nyt näkyvissä Config-välilehti (filetrees.py)
  • Framework parannukset:
  • Nyt integroituu Atlassian n Jira vianseurantajärjestelmästä sekä Bugzilla (jira.py)
  • Toimii pitkälti samalla tavalla kuin Bugzillan yhdentymistä. Tarkemmat tiedot nettisivuilta.
  • & quot; collate_file & quot; toiminnot useita tiedostoja uusiksi (sandbox.py)
  • kuviot muodossa & quot; tiedot *: tiedot * .dump & quot; pitäisi käyttäytyä intuitiivisemmin, mutta ei voi olla täysin takaisin-yhteensopiva.
  • Lue muuttoliike muistiinpanoja ja tiedot nettisivuilta.
  • & quot; run_dependent_text & quot; tehostettu suodattamiseksi pois osia tekstistä (rundependent.py)
  • Voi nyt määrittää, alku ja loppu linjat suodatetaan kautta esimerkiksi & Quot; {[- & gt;]} & quot; syntaksi
  • Versioituja config tiedostot voidaan nyt sijoittaa & quot; extra_search_directory & quot; sijainnit (testmodel.py)
  • Aiemmin vain tuodut tiedostot löytynyt siellä.
  • & quot; suppress_stderr_text & quot; tukee nyt samaa syntaksia kuin & quot; run_dependent_text & quot; (Oletus / __ init __. Py)
  • Mahdollistaa esim. MultiLine suodatus
  • & quot; text_diff_program_max_file_size & quot; -asetuksen nyt nimeksi & quot; MAX_FILE_SIZE & quot; ja on nyt sanakirja (comparefile.py)
  • Avaimet nimet ohjelmia. Myös saada varoituksen dialogi jos yrität avata liian suuren tiedoston GUI.
  • Nyt esitetään & quot; USECASE_HOME & quot; testaamiseen GUI kanssa esim. PyUseCase & quot; pyusecase_files & quot; (Oletus / __ init __. Py)
  • Aiemmin sallittu SUT: n usecase tiedostoja sekaantua kanssa TextTest oma.
  • default.CountTest käsikirjoituksen raportoi loppusumman lopussa (oletus / __ init __. Py)
  • Erä raportti parannukset:
  • Nyt automaattisesti & quot; kojelauta & quot; sivu, jossa on linkit kaikki raportit ja nykytila ​​(erä / __ init __. py)
  • Mukana ilmaiseksi & quot; -coll & quot ;, voidaan tehdä myös yksin kautta -S batch.GenerateSummaryPage. Tarkastele verkkosivustoa.
  • voivat nyt luoda erillisen kertomuksen taulukot sisältävä (esim) suorituskyvyn tai muistin tiedot. (Testoverview.py)
  • Käytä -coll web.performance: tarkemmat tiedot nettisivuilta.
  • Jos useat versiot ovat läsnä samalla sivulla, & quot; loppusumman & quot; näytetään.
  • rivit tai taulukoita, jotka sisältävät vain & quot; N / A & quot; ei enää näytetä (testoverview.py)
  • Jos lähdetiedostot ovat tyhjiä, se korostaa tätä ja ehdottaa Levy saattaa olla täynnä (testoverview.py)
  • Solut on nyt vihjeet osoittavat mikä testi ja päivämäärä ne ovat, välttää vieritys suuret taulukot (testoverview.py)
  • Saat sähköposti raportin, SMTP-todennus on nyt mahdollista (erä / __ init __. Py)
  • Uusi asetustiedostoon asetukset & quot; smtp_server_username & quot; ja & quot; smtp_server_password & quot;
  • Grid Engine (LSF / SGE) parannuksia:
  • Grid Engine komentorivi nyt näkyy & quot; Run Info & quot; välilehti dynaamisen GUI. (Textinfo.py)
  • Self-testi / Sisäinen muutokset:
  • PyUseCase instrumentointi poistettu, käytä PyUseCase 3.0, joka ei tarvitse tätä.
  • Käyttää UI kartta tiedostot (alle jne) sijaan, ja komentorivin PyUseCase.
  • Nyt automaattisesti poimia paikallinen PyUseCase arkiston nimeltään & quot; pyusecase & quot; (Texttest.py)
  • Virhekorjauksia:
  • kiihdyttimiä & quot; Cut Test & quot ;, & quot; Kopio Test & quot; ja & quot; Liitä Test & quot; poistetaan käytöstä, kun teksti vekotin on keskittynyt (adminactions.py)
  • tarkoittaa, että voit käyttää Ctrl + X, Ctrl + V, Ctrl + C tekstin manipulointi TextTest ikkunat.
  • Äskettäin perustetut sovellukset toimivat nyt ilman uudelleenkäynnistystä jos versionhallinta on käytössä (controller.py)
  • kiertää Mercurial bugi uudelleennimeäminen tiedostoja symbolisia linkkejä nimissä (hg.py)
  • & quot; copy_test_path: $ ENV_VAR & quot; nyt tee mitään jos ENV_VAR on tyhjä (sandbox.py)
  • Aikaisemmin aseta se $ TEXTTEST_SANDBOX /. mikä voisi aiheuttaa ongelmia.
  • Jos & quot; collate_script & quot; tuottaa tyhjän tiedoston ei-tyhjä tulo, älä kirjoita tyhjä tiedosto (sandbox.py)
  • & quot; extra_version & quot; nyt lukea sen GUI-testaus config eikä vain olettaa se on sama kuin emoyhtiön (guiplugins.py)
  • & quot; save_filtered_file_stems & quot; tukee nyt tiedostonimi laajennuksia (comparefile.py)
  • Scripts kuten default.CountTest ei lähetä vääriä postia jos ajaa erän lippu (& quot; -B & quot;) (oletus / __ init __. Py)
  • Älä stacktrace jos ympäristömuuttujan & quot; copy_test_path & quot; ei ole olemassa (sandbox.py)
  • Älä stacktrace jos & quot; collate_script & quot; ei ole olemassa (sandbox.py)
  • Älä stacktrace jos argumentti & quot; -CP & quot; (Tai Times Run) on virheellinen (oletus / __ init __. Py)
  • Älä stacktrace jos suhteellinen tulkki ohjelma ei löytynyt (oletus / __ init __. Py)
  • Älä stacktrace jos sama sovelluksen nimen kahdesti & quot; -a app, sovellus & quot; komentorivillä (testmodel.py)

Mikä on uusi versiossa 3.15:

  • melkoisesti jälkeen on tapahtunut 3,14 kesäkuun alussa.
  • Ei ehkä ole yhtä merkittävä parannus, joka erottuu, mutta monet pienemmät asiat, jotka ovat todennäköisesti hyödyllistä.
  • esimerkiksi, on nyt mahdollista uusintana testejä suoraan dynaamisen GUI.
  • & quot; Optiot & quot; tiedostoja voidaan käyttää samalla tavalla kuin ympäristön tiedostoja, jotta ne voidaan sijoittaa mihin tahansa hierarkiassa ja päällekkäisyyttä komentorivivalitsimia voidaan poistaa.

Mikä on uusi versiossa 3.14:

  • Yleiset GUI parannukset:
  • Tämä Vaihdokas nyt näkyvissä GUI (helpdialogs.py) Valitse Ohje-valikosta / Muuta Lokit
  • Toimipaikat valittu FileChoosers nyt päästä muistaa (plugins.py) Joten sinun ei tarvitse jatkaa etsimistä samaan paikkaan.
  • Staattinen GUI parannukset:
  • & quot; Luo tiedosto & quot; toiminnallisuutta parannettu. (Default_gui.py) nyt käsitellä hakemistoja oikein, ja voit valita lähde filechooser nyt.
  • Voi nyt suorittaa kaikki testit sviitissä valitsemalla vain että sviitti (default_gui.py) toimii myös elvyttämään ja säästää valintoja.
  • Framework parannukset:
  • Voi nyt ajaa testejä etäkoneen (UNIX vain) (default.py) toimii myös, jos tiedostojärjestelmä ei jaeta. Uusi config merkinnät & quot; remote_shell_program & quot; ja & quot; remote_copy_program & quot ;. Tarkemmat tiedot nettisivuilta.
  • TextTest nyt kerää poistua koodit testattava järjestelmä oletuksena (default.py) Vain kirjoittaa tiedostoja nollasta tila. Voidaan poistaa käytöstä discard_file
  • Voi nyt poistaa tiettyjä elementtejä versioidut asetustiedostoihin (plugins.py) Uudet syntaksia {Tyhjennä}
  • Voi nyt kertoa TextTest yhdistää tietoja hakemistojen keskenään (sandbox.py) Käytä uusia config asettamalla & quot; copy_test_path_merge & quot ;. & Quot; copy_test_path & quot; aiheuttaa hakemistoja korvataan.
  • Voi nyt suodattaa liukulukuja eroja tietyn toleranssin (rundependent.py/fpdiff.py) Uudet config tiedosto asettamalla & quot; floating_point_tolerance & quot ;. Katso asiakirjat verkkosivuilla. Kiitos Michael Behrisch tähän. Voi nyt koota tulos tiedostoja useita mahdollisia lähde malleja (sandbox.py) Pohjimmiltaan collate_file on nyt lista. Voi vaatia muuttoliike teoriassa.
  • Tuotannosta irrotetut unohtaa muut virheet virheraportteja & quot; sisäinen virhe & quot; (Knownbugs.py) Nyt erilliset valintaruudut näitä asioita, kun teet & quot; Anna vikatietojen & quot;
  • ötökät merkitty & quot; sisäinen virhe & quot; saada raportoitu mieluummin & quot; tunnettu bugi & quot; (Knownbugs.py) Entinen ovat yleensä joitakin katastrofaaliset yleisiä ympäristö vika
  • Config tiedosto asettamalla & quot; performance_use_normalised _% & quot; nimeksi geneeristen sovellus (default.py) nyt nimeltään & quot; use_normalised_percentage_change & quot; pohtia mahdollisen käytön muihin tarkoituksiin. Vanha nimi lyhennysmerkintä.
  • Liikenne mekanismi ei ota asynkroninen tiedosto muokkaukset ovat mahdollisia enää (traffic.py)
  • tulee erikseen luetella ohjelmat, jotka voivat tehdä tämän: näppäintä & quot; asynkroninen & quot; & quot; collect_traffic & quot; config tiedosto asetus, joka on nyt sanakirja.
  • Ei enää ohittaa puuttuvia liikennettä ja usecase tiedostoja. (Default.py) & quot; definition_file_stems & quot; on nyt sanakirja, jossa kohteita, kuten nämä voidaan näppäilty & quot; uudistua & quot;
  • Nyt perustettu kassalla jos voimme juostessa skriptejä, kuten verkkosivuilla sukupolvi (default.py) Keinot loppusijoitustilan sijainti voi riippua TEXTTEST_CHECKOUT.
  • Poimii & quot; ominaisuuksia & quot; tiedostoja samaan tapaan kuin & quot; ympäristö & quot; tiedostot (testmodel.py) Käytetään Java-sovelluksia. Katso verkkosivuilla lisätietoja.
  • Oletus sijainnin väliaikaiset tiedostot muuttunut (engine.py) Nyt kirjoittaa ~ / .texttest / tmp sijasta $ TEMP tai ~ / texttesttmp
  • versionhallinta Browser parannukset / korjauksia:
  • Hallinto toimintoja Päivitä VCS oikein (version_control.py) Nimeä, Siirrä ja Poista myös tehdä niin VCS testejä VCS-ohjaus
  • Voi nyt lisätä VCS kautta TextTest (version_control.py) Erillinen toimia haluamasi valikon
  • Nyt tukee Bazaar ja Mercurial sekä CVS (bzr.py/hg.py/version_control.py)
  • piilottaminen & quot; tuntematon & quot; luokka toimii nyt oikein (version_control.py)
  • Sisäinen muutokset:
  • TextTest nyt jaettu paketteja niin paljon tiedostot on siirretty noin
  • Virhekorjauksia:
  • Liikenne mekanismi ei käsittele hakemiston muutot poistamalla kaikki tiedostot enää (traffic.py) Oikeastaan ​​tallentaa ja Toistaa hakemiston poisto suoraan.
  • Ei enää lippu kulkee kadonneeksi jos batch_collect_compulsory_version päällekkäinen versiot annettu komentorivillä (batch.py)
  • Python 2,6 pitäisi tuota ärsyttävää viestejä vanhentunut moduulit enempää.
  • kiertää GTK 2,14 vian tiedosto chooser käsittely, ei enää roikkua
  • Race ehto poistetaan virtuaalipalvelin käsittely UNIX: ei saa vuotaa virtuaalisia palvelimia enää (startXvfb.py)
  • Ei enää stacktrace jos & quot; tulkki & quot; on virheellinen polku (oletus / __ init __. py)
  • Ei enää stacktrace kun asetella testeistä, jos ei kirjoitusoikeudet tiedostot (default_gui.py)
  • Nyt näyttää oikean testin nimet tilarivillä jälkeen uudelleennimennäksi (engine.py)
  • Älä kaatua, jos kopiointi tai liikkuvat sarja ja sen sisältö (default_gui.py)
  • Nyt toimii ajaa paikallisesti bin. Kiitos jälleen Michael Behrisch (texttest.py) & quot; Extra versiot & quot; kirjoittaa järkevä erän arkistoon paikoissa kun ei versio annettu komentorivillä (batch.py)
  • Verkkosivusto sukupolven teoksia & quot; Extra versio & quot; sovellukset vaikka vanhempi on estetty tai ei ole tietoja (batch.py)

Vastaavia ohjelmistoja

fakeldap
fakeldap

11 May 15

lava-serial
lava-serial

15 Apr 15

nose-quickunit
nose-quickunit

20 Feb 15

LAVA Server
LAVA Server

20 Feb 15

Muu ohjelmistojen kehittäjä Geoff Bache

PyUseCase
PyUseCase

11 May 15

Kommentit TextTest

Kommentteja ei löytynyt
Lisää kommentti
Ota kuvia!